How to evaluate surround sound versus stereo setups for competitive play, spatial awareness, and immersion balance
In competitive gaming, the choice between surround sound and stereo headsets hinges on spatial clarity, cross-talk reduction, and personal comfort. This guide weighs design, audio calibration, and real-world performance to help players select the setup that optimizes reflexes, team communication, and immersion without sacrificing critical awareness during high-stakes matches.

In the evolving world of competitive gaming, audio quality is not a mere enhancement but a strategic factor that influences reaction times, positioning, and communication. Surround sound systems promise intricate spatial cues, where gunshots, footsteps, and environmental sounds originate from defined directions. Stereo headsets, meanwhile, offer a focused, unified soundstage that can reduce noise clutter and simplify decision-making under pressure. The decision often boils down to the game’s audio engine, the headset or speaker setup, and the player’s preference for directional cues versus overall clarity. Understanding the trade-offs helps players tune their setups to their playstyle and role.
To begin, consider the core purpose of your gaming sessions. If you compete in fast-paced arena shooters or battle royales, precise localization can shave crucial milliseconds off movement decisions. Surround configurations aim to recreate a three-dimensional soundfield, aiding you in judging vertical and horizontal cues. On the other hand, if you frequently participate in long, tense skirmishes where mic chatter is high, a clean stereo headset with strong izolating properties might reduce audio bleed and improve focus. The right choice emerges when you map your regular maps, teams, and expected audio challenges to the capabilities of each system.
Comparing localization accuracy under consistent testing conditions
Calibration is the invisible cornerstone of reliable audio perception. Begin by setting a baseline volume that’s comfortable yet audible across all channels without reaching ear fatigue. In surround setups, test virtual positions by noting whether sound sources appear from the intended directions and elevations. If sounds feel pushed or misaligned, adjust the height channel and headset tilt, ensuring your ears align with the drivers correctly. In stereo configurations, pay attention to the perceived width of the soundfield and how well you can discern flank cues during rapid exchanges. Consistency across sessions matters more than a single perfectly tuned moment.

Noise handling and channel separation play a critical role in competitive contexts. Surround sound can reveal subtle environmental cues but may introduce competing data if the room is noisy or poorly treated. Use a noise gate and careful EQ to preserve the most relevant cues (footsteps, weapon recoil, step cadence) while suppressing extraneous sounds. Stereo setups often excel when designed with strategic separation between the left and right channels, helping to isolate enemies behind cover or around corners. The balancing act is to maximize actionable information without overwhelming your cognitive bandwidth.

Localization accuracy is a practical measure of how well a system translates in-game events into perceivable space. In surround configurations, you should experience a cohesive sense of directionality, with footsteps and gunfire mapped to distinct quadrants. However, if the encoding becomes inconsistent or jittery, your brain may struggle to form stable spatial representations during high-speed exchanges. Stereo headsets can deliver sharper horizontal cues, making it easier to track targets within a narrow field of view. The ideal choice aligns with your typical combat scenarios and the levels of cross-cue competition you encounter.

Real-world testing is essential to avoid relying solely on theoretical advantages. Play a handful of drills designed to stress different audio aspects: sprinting past cover, reloading in cover, and hearing abilities through walls if supported by the engine. Record your reaction times, note your confidence in tracking enemies, and compare across devices. Adjust gain staging on the amp or DAC, then retest with the same scenarios. The objective is to reach a stable baseline where improvements in one dimension don’t degrade another critical cue, such as voice chat clarity.

Immersion is a double-edged sword in competitive contexts. While surround sound can create a convincing game world that improves spatial feel and audial depth, it may also blur important cues if the mix becomes overly enveloping. A highly immersive setup should still preserve crisp, actionable signals like whispers from teammates or urgent footsteps behind you. In this sense, a well-tuned stereo headset might deliver a more disciplined perspective, ensuring you hear crucial cues without the distraction of ambient reverberations. The best choice respects both immersion and the rapid exchange of vital information.
A practical path is to use immersion selectively through advanced EQ presets or software profiles. Some players toggle between modes—one optimized for immersion in campaign or exploration, another tuned for ranked matches where precision is paramount. The ability to switch quickly can save mental energy during tournaments and reduce fatigue at long sessions. Beyond software, consider physical comfort, headset weight distribution, and clamping pressure, all of which influence how long you can maintain peak focus. Comfort directly supports consistent perceptual acuity across extended play.

The listening environment can drastically tilt the balance between surround and stereo effectiveness. Untreated rooms with reflective surfaces often introduce reverberation that blurs directional cues, undermining even the most sophisticated virtual audio. Surround setups may exaggerate these reflections, creating a confusing halo around enemies and obstacles. Conversely, a well-damped room with absorptive panels can enhance the clarity of both surround and stereo configurations by reducing echo and ensuring that relevant cues stand out. If a dedicated room isn’t feasible, choose furniture and layout that minimize flutter echoes and standing waves.
The placement of speakers or the orientation of a headset matters too. In a desktop stereo arrangement, speaker positioning and listening distance determine how accurately you perceive lateral movement. For surround systems, ceiling height, speaker angles, and subwoofer integration all shape the perceived depth. A practical approach is to simulate typical play angles during tests and adjust each element until your sense of space aligns with your in-game expectations. Then, test under varied lighting and noise conditions to ensure performance remains robust across common gaming setups.
For fast-paced shooters with rapid target transitions, prioritize clear directional cues and rapid isolation from ambient sound. A high-quality stereo headset with strong isolation often yields the least cognitive load, enabling quick reactions and accurate target tracking. If you’re a player who relies on environmental cues to time a push or retreat, a well-calibrated surround system can provide richer contextual awareness without sacrificing core cues. The trick is to find a balanced mix that preserves critical audio paths while offering enough spatial depth to inform maneuver decisions.
For strategy-based or methodical play where subtlety matters, a surround setup may offer advantages in perceiving distant threats and team coordination. When communicating with teammates, you want your voice channel to remain clean, and the game audio to deliver directional hints without masking dialogue. In either case, invest in a quality DAC or sound card, update drivers, and use consistent volume curves across sessions. The right configuration is the one that keeps you mentally agile, never overwhelmed, and consistently capable of making informed choices under pressure.
